Minimum Qualifications (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ities)

 

  • Be at least 18 years old; have a High School Diploma or equivalent
  • Have at least 1-2 years of experience working in an early learning environment with Infants/Waddlers
  • Ability to read, write, and communicate using proper English grammar
  • Have a MERIT account including a STARS ID number.
  • Child Care Basics Initial Training (via MERIT)
  • Infant/Child CPR and First Aid certification and Bloodborne Pathogens certification.
  • Must clear full background check and must pass health screening including TB Test.
  • Provide proof of Vaccination
  • Food Handlers Permit.
  • Current Safe Sleep Certificate (https://dcyftraining.com).
